虚拟币盗U源码开源下载:多语言USDT秒U系统深度定制
多语言挖矿授权虚拟币秒U源码USDT二开盗U系统安装与配置指南
一、项目概述
该项目是一个支持多语言的虚拟币挖矿授权系统,允许用户通过挖矿赚取USDT、ETH、TRX等虚拟币。系统基于PHP + MySQL架构,使用ThinkPHP开发框架,支持USDT二次开发。以下是安装与配置的详细步骤。
二、安装与配置步骤
第一步:安装宝塔和环境
- 安装宝塔控制面板
- 通过 SSH 连接到服务器。
- 运行以下命令安装宝塔控制面板(适用于CentOS系统):
wget -O install.sh http://download.bt.cn/install/install_6.0.sh && bash install.sh
- 安装完成后,访问宝塔面板的后台并登录。
- 安装PHP和MySQL
- 在宝塔面板中,点击 软件商店,选择 PHP 7.3 和 MySQL 5.6,点击安装。
- 配置 PHP 7.3 作为默认版本,确保兼容性。
- 安装扩展
- 在宝塔面板的PHP扩展中,安装以下扩展:
- fileinfo:用于文件类型识别。
- redis:缓存支持。
- gmp:大数运算支持。
- 在宝塔面板的PHP扩展中,安装以下扩展:
- 删除禁用函数
- 修改 PHP配置 文件:
- 进入宝塔面板 > PHP设置 > 禁用函数,删除
putenv
等敏感函数的禁用设置,确保系统正常运行。
- 进入宝塔面板 > PHP设置 > 禁用函数,删除
- 修改 PHP配置 文件:
第二步:配置网站
- 添加后台站点
- 在宝塔面板中,点击 网站 > 添加站点,输入后台站点的域名或IP地址。
- 上传并解压 秒U.zip 源代码到站点目录。
- 绑定域名与设置伪静态
- 在宝塔面板中,将站点的域名绑定到 public 目录,确保正确指向。
- 设置 ThinkPHP伪静态规则:
- 进入宝塔 > 网站 > 点击站点设置 > 伪静态设置,配置如下规则:
R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Rule ^(.*)$ /index.php?s=$1 [QSA,L]
- 进入宝塔 > 网站 > 点击站点设置 > 伪静态设置,配置如下规则:
第三步:配置数据库和前端
- 上传并导入数据库
- 将 数据库文件 上传到服务器,并在 MySQL 中创建新的数据库。
- 使用 phpMyAdmin 或命令行工具导入数据库文件。
- 登录MySQL数据库:
mysql -u root -p
- 创建数据库并导入:
CREATE DATABASE mining; USE mining; SOURCE /path/to/database.sql;
- 修改数据库配置
- 在项目的根目录下,找到 .env 配置文件。
- 修改数据库配置:
DB_CONNECTION=mysql DB_HOST=127.0.0.1 DB_PORT=3306 DB_DATABASE=mining DB_USERNAME=root DB_PASSWORD=yourpassword
- 上传前端文件
- 将 ETH 和 TRX 的前端文件上传到服务器,并解压到指定目录。
- 添加前端站点
- 在宝塔面板中,点击 网站 > 添加站点,将前端站点的根目录指向 ETH 和 TRX 的文件目录。
- 设置伪静态规则,与后台站点相同。
第四步:配置CORS和定时任务
- 配置CORS
- 在
application/config.php
中,找到cors_request_domain
设置,配置允许的跨域请求域名。
'cors_request_domain' => '*', // 设置为*表示允许所有来源域名访问
- 在
- 配置定时任务
- 在宝塔面板中,进入 计划任务 > 添加任务,配置定时任务:
- 设置任务每小时执行一次。
- 任务内容如下:
curl http://your-backend-domain/api/index/commission
- 这样定时任务每小时会访问后台接口,自动执行相关操作。
- 在宝塔面板中,进入 计划任务 > 添加任务,配置定时任务:
三、系统配置完毕后的常见问题
- 问题:网站加载异常,提示文件不存在
- 解决方法:检查 伪静态规则 是否正确配置,确保规则适配ThinkPHP框架。
- 问题:数据库连接失败
- 解决方法:检查
.env
配置文件中的数据库连接信息,确保数据库服务器地址、用户名和密码正确。
- 解决方法:检查
- 问题:定时任务未执行
- 解决方法:确保服务器上的定时任务服务运行正常,检查宝塔面板中的计划任务设置是否正确。
四、总结
通过以上步骤,您可以顺利安装和配置多语言挖矿授权虚拟币秒U源码。系统支持USDT、ETH、TRX等币种的挖矿授权,提供多种货币操作及授权功能,同时可对接第三方支付和公众号接口。部署过程相对简单,特别适合新手站长,提供了高效的后台管理系统和定时任务支持。
该项目适用于有虚拟币交易或挖矿需求的运营商,可以轻松搭建并进行运营。如果需要二次开发或定制功能,源码开源,您可以根据需要进行修改。
声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。